Chapter 37 She Can’t Afford It

Her hatred stung his heart, but he remained resolute.

‘I’m not asking you to remain blind forever. It’s temporary. Isabella needs the surgery now, and I will find suitable eyes for you as soon as possible…”

Before he could finish his sentence, Natalie slapped him hard across the face.

Temporary?

What was that supposed to mean?

She glared at Cedric one last time and turned to open the hospital room door. Then, she said coldly, “She can’t afford my eyes, and neither can you.”

With that, she left, ignoring the man who radiated an icy aura behind her.

Cedric had finally said it.

Natalie had given up on having any illusions about him, but it still hurt when it came to this moment.

Ten years. They had ten years together…!

What drove him to make such a decision for another woman?!

What was the reason behind it all? 1

Natalie asked herself these questions repeatedly but couldn’t find the answers.

If Cedric didn’t tell her, she… would never know.

Natalie had no recollection of how she left the hospital. In the car, she called Bianca. Blanca must have been very busy since she only answered at the very last second.

She didn’t sound like she was in a good mood.
